引言
在当今快速发展的技术时代,高效框架已成为提升工作效率的关键。无论是软件开发、数据分析还是日常办公,掌握高效框架的优化秘诀,能够让我们在工作中游刃有余。本文将深入探讨如何通过一招走遍天下,轻松提升工作效率。
一、高效框架概述
1.1 高效框架的定义
高效框架是指能够帮助开发者快速实现功能、提高开发效率、降低开发成本的软件开发框架。它通常包括一套完整的编程规范、设计模式和组件库,使得开发者可以专注于业务逻辑的实现。
1.2 高效框架的分类
根据应用领域,高效框架可分为以下几类:
- Web开发框架:如Spring、Django、Rails等。
- 移动开发框架:如Flutter、React Native等。
- 数据分析框架:如Pandas、NumPy等。
- 办公自动化框架:如Openpyxl、JasperReports等。
二、高效框架优化秘诀
2.1 熟练掌握框架原理
要优化高效框架,首先需要深入了解其原理。熟悉框架的设计模式、组件结构和核心功能,有助于我们更好地利用框架,提高工作效率。
2.2 合理选择框架
根据项目需求和团队技术栈,选择合适的框架至关重要。以下是一些选择框架的参考因素:
- 开发效率:框架是否能够快速实现功能,降低开发成本。
- 生态圈:框架是否有丰富的组件库和第三方库支持。
- 性能:框架的性能是否满足项目需求。
- 可维护性:框架的代码结构是否清晰,易于维护。
2.3 优化配置和参数
针对不同框架,我们可以通过调整配置和参数来优化性能。以下是一些常见的优化方法:
- 缓存:利用缓存技术减少数据库访问次数,提高系统响应速度。
- 异步处理:使用异步编程模型提高系统并发能力。
- 负载均衡:通过负载均衡技术分散访问压力,提高系统可用性。
2.4 遵循最佳实践
遵循框架的最佳实践,如代码规范、设计模式等,有助于提高代码质量和可维护性。以下是一些常见的最佳实践:
- 模块化:将功能模块化,提高代码复用性。
- 代码复用:利用框架提供的组件和工具,实现代码复用。
- 单元测试:编写单元测试,确保代码质量。
三、案例分析
以下是一些高效框架优化的实际案例:
- Spring框架:通过配置优化、异步处理等技术,提高系统性能。
- Pandas框架:利用并行计算技术,加速数据处理速度。
- React Native框架:通过优化组件渲染和状态管理,提高应用性能。
四、总结
掌握高效框架的优化秘诀,能够帮助我们轻松提升工作效率。通过熟练掌握框架原理、合理选择框架、优化配置和参数以及遵循最佳实践,我们可以在工作中游刃有余,实现一招走遍天下的目标。
